在数字化时代,数据存储和管理的方式正在迅速演变。区块链云存储软件作为一种新兴的技术解决方案,凭借其独特的去中心化和安全性,正在逐渐引起人们的关注。而区块链作为一种加密技术,不仅可以防止数据篡改,还能提供更高层次的数据隐私保护。
本文将深入探讨区块链云存储软件的运作机制、优势、应用和面临的挑战,帮助读者更好地理解这一前沿技术。
--- ## 2. 区块链云存储的基本概念 ### 区块链的定义区块链是一种分布式账本技术(DLT),由一系列按时间顺序连接的区块构成。每个区块包含一组交易数据,并通过加密技术确保数据的安全性和不可篡改性。区块链的去中心化特性意味着没有单一的控制者,这在数据存储上极大地提高了透明度和信任度。
### 云存储的定义云存储技术允许用户通过互联网将数据存储在远程服务器上,而非本地硬盘。云存储服务提供商使用虚拟化技术,高效管理和分配存储资源。云存储提高了数据的可访问性和备份的便捷性,但也带来了数据隐私和安全性的问题。
### 如何实现数据的去中心化存储区块链云存储通过将数据分散存储在多个节点上而非集中式存储,确保了数据的安全性与隐私。这些数据块只在区块链上留有指向信息,从而降低了黑客攻击的风险,使得数据存储更加安全。
--- ## 3. 区块链云存储的工作原理 ### 数据加密与安全性在区块链云存储系统中,数据在上传之前会经过加密处理,只有拥有特定权限的用户才能解密和访问。这一过程确保了数据在传输和存储过程中不易被窃取或篡改。
### 数据存储与检索过程用户上传数据后,数据被分片并分散存储在网络中的多个节点。这种冗余存储方式即使在某些节点失效的情况下,用户仍可从其他节点安全地访问所需数据。
### 节点的角色与功能分布式网络中的每一个节点都充当数据存储和共识的参与者。它们不仅保存数据,还参与验证交易,确保整个网络的安全性和完整性。这种机制使得区块链云存储系统更加稳定与高效。
--- ## 4. 区块链云存储的优势 ### 数据安全性区块链技术通过加密和去中心化存储提供了极高的数据安全性。由于数据不易被单一节点控制,因此即使部分节点遭到攻击,整个系统仍能正常运作。更多的数据备份分散在不同地点也避免了单点故障带来的风险。
### 去中心化带来的信任去中心化技术使得用户无须信任单一的数据存储服务提供商,而是依赖整个网络的共识机制。区块链上每一笔交易都保持公开透明,任何人都可以验证交易记录,从而增强用户对数据存储的信任度。
### 降低存储成本通过去中心化存储,用户只需支付少量的存储费用,减少了对大型云存储服务商的依赖。同时,随着技术的发展,区块链云存储的成本有望进一步降低,提高其普及性。
--- ## 5. 区块链云存储应用案例 ### 个人数据存储越来越多的用户开始使用区块链云存储来保存个人信息、照片和视频等敏感数据,例如身份证信息和医疗记录。这种存储方式不仅可以保障个人隐私,还能有效防止数据被滥用。
### 企业数据管理企业在管理客户数据、财务信息和运营记录时,采用区块链存储可提高数据准确性和安全性。借助区块链的透明性,企业可以更可靠地与合作伙伴进行数据共享,减少信息不对称带来的风险。
### Blockchain技术的其他应用不仅限于云存储,区块链技术还广泛应用于数字资产管理、智能合约、供应链管理等多个领域。这些应用都受益于区块链的去中心化、安全性和透明性。
--- ## 6. 区块链云存储的挑战与未来 ### 当前技术的限制尽管区块链云存储技术日益发展,但仍面临诸多挑战。例如,存储速度较慢、数据处理能力有限等问题都需要解决。此外,公众对区块链技术的接受度和了解程度也需提高。
### 未来的技术趋势与突破未来,区块链技术可能与人工智能、大数据等新兴技术结合,以提升数据处理能力和安全性。同时,如何缩短交易确认时间和降低能耗也是技术发展的重要方向。
### 政策与法律的影响各国对区块链技术的政策监管仍在不断调整与演变。法律的透明性与合规性是未来区块链云存储能够健康发展的基础,需加强各方的合作以推动法律环境的完善。
--- ## 7. 常见问题解答 ### 常见 区块链云存储的安全性如何保障? ### 常见 区块链云存储的存储费用是否高于传统云存储? ### 常见 如何选择合适的区块链云存储提供商? ### 常见 区块链云存储是否适用于所有类型的数据? ### 常见 区块链云存储可以应用在哪些行业? ### 常见 如何评估区块链云存储的未来发展? --- 以上是一个关于区块链云存储软件的结构性大纲和探讨,您可以根据具体需求进行扩展和填充。每个部分的详细内容应涵盖相关理论、实例分析和未来发展建议。